Description
1. Compliant with JIS standards;
2. Features C-shaped retaining rings for securing cylinder body to front/rear covers, with riveted piston-rod assembly ensuring compactness and reliability;
3. Precision-honed bore surface enhances wear resistance and operational longevity;
4. Extended front cover guiding system improves alignment stability;
5. Space-saving profile maximizes installation flexibility in confined spaces;
6. Integrated sensor grooves along cylinder periphery facilitate seamless sensor mounting;
7. Comprehensive selection of standardized mounting accessories available;

AirTAC ACQ80X200BH Ultra-Thin Cylinder Specifications

  • Model: ACQ80X200BH
  • Type: Compact double-acting pneumatic cylinder
  • Bore size: 80mm (±0.1mm tolerance)
  • Stroke: 200mm (adjustable cushioning)
  • Operating pressure: 0.1–0.9 MPa
  • Temperature range: -20℃ to 80℃
  • Cushion type: Adjustable pneumatic buffer
  • Port size: Rc1/4 (G1/4 optional)
  • Mounting style: Front flange with rectangular base
  • Rod material: Hard chrome-plated carbon steel
  • Tube material: Anodized aluminum alloy
  • Seal material: NBR (nitrile rubber)
  • Weight: 3.2kg (excluding accessories)
  • Dimensions:
    • Body length: 260mm
    • Width: 105mm (flange mounting surface)
    • Height: 85mm (including rod eye)
    • Stroke tolerance: ±1.5mm

Ultra-low profile cylinder optimized for space-constrained automation systems. Features precision-ground rod guides for minimal lateral play (±0.15mm) and integrated magnetic sensor slots (M5x0.8 mounting threads). The BH variant includes reinforced mounting bosses capable of withstanding 2.5x standard side loads.

Typical Applications:
  • High-density pick-and-place systems in electronics assembly
  • Clamping mechanisms in CNC fixture tables
  • Medical device actuation requiring smooth operation
  • Packaging machine ejector systems
  • Pharmaceutical blister pack forming machines
Installation guidelines: Maintain ≤0.05mm/m alignment tolerance during mounting. Lubricate with ISO VG32 hydraulic oil during initial installation. Not recommended for vertical downward thrust applications without external guidance.
Performance Characteristics:
  • Max piston speed: 500mm/s (with cushioning engaged)
  • Breakaway pressure: ≤0.08 MPa
  • Leakage rate: <5 cm³/min at 0.5 MPa
  • Lubrication: Pre-lubricated (maintenance-free for 2000km stroke)
